Sultan’s Turkish Pide Gungahlin seems to have seen better days.

James sent this in:

An employee was roaming around outside when I took these. He was very keen to make sure I was aware this was as a result of “minor structural issues”. A jack hammer was being used inside to tear up the tiled floor in an effort to correct said issues.
